++---+-------------------------------------------------+----------+------------------------------------------------------+
+| # | Issue | Jira ID | Description |
++---+-------------------------------------------------+----------+------------------------------------------------------+
+| 1 | DHCPv4 client: Client responses to DHCPv4 OFFER | CSIT-129 | Client replies with DHCPv4 REQUEST message when |
+| | sent with different XID. | | received DHCPv4 OFFER message with different (wrong) |
+| | | | XID. |
++---+-------------------------------------------------+----------+------------------------------------------------------+
+| 2 | Softwire - MAP-E: Incorrect calculation of IPv6 | CSIT-398 | IPv6 destination address is wrongly calculated in |
+| | destination address when IPv4 prefix is 0. | | case that IPv4 prefix is equal to 0 and IPv6 prefix |
+| | | | is less than 40. |
++---+-------------------------------------------------+----------+------------------------------------------------------+
+| 3 | Softwire - MAP-E: Map domain is created when | CSIT-399 | Map domain is created in case that the sum of suffix |
+| | incorrect parameters provided. | | length of IPv4 prefix and PSID length is greater |
+| | | | than EA bits length. IPv6 destination address |
+| | | | contains bits writen with PSID over the EA-bit |
+| | | | length when IPv4 packet is sent. |
++---+-------------------------------------------------+----------+------------------------------------------------------+
+| 4 | IPv6 RA: Incorrect IPv6 destination address in | CSIT-409 | Wrong IPv6 destination address (ff02::1) is used in |
+| | response to ICMPv6 Router Solicitation. | | ICMPv6 Router Advertisement packet sent as a |
+| | | | response to received ICMPv6 Router Solicitation |
+| | | | packet. |
++---+-------------------------------------------------+----------+------------------------------------------------------+
+| 5 | IPFIX: IPv6_src key name reported instead of | CSIT-402 | The report contains IPv6_src key name instead of |
+| | IPv6_dst. | | IPv6_dst when classify session is configured with |
+| | | | IPv6 destination address. Anyhow the correct IPv6 |
+| | | | destination address is reported. |
++---+-------------------------------------------------+----------+------------------------------------------------------+
+| 6 | IPv4 + VLAN: Processing of tagged frame does | CSIT-564 | Dot1q tagged packets are thrown away in case of IPv4 |
+| | not work with virtio driver. | | routing on interface binded to virtio driver. Issue |
+| | | | with VIRL test simulation environment. |
++---+-------------------------------------------------+----------+------------------------------------------------------+
+| 7 | Vhost-user: QEMU reconnect does not work. | CSIT-565 | Using QEMU 2.5.0 that does not support vhost-user |
+| | | | reconnect. It requires moving CSIT VIRL environment |
+| | | | to QEMU 2.7.0. |
++---+-------------------------------------------------+----------+------------------------------------------------------+
+| 8 | Centos7: LISP and VXLAN sporadic test failures. | CSIT-566 | Observing sporadic crashes of DUT1 VM during LISP |
+| | | | and VXLAN test executions, what leads to failure of |
+| | | | all other tests in the suite. NOTE: After upgrading |
+| | | | one of the VIRL servers host from Ubuntu14.04 to |
+| | | | 16.04, DUT1 VM stops crashing, but tests keep |
+| | | | failing sporadically 1-in-100. Possible root cause |
+| | | | identified - unexpected IPv6 RA packets upsetting |
+| | | | some test component. Currently suspecting |
+| | | | environment or CSIT issue, but can not exclude VPP, |
+| | | | further troubleshooting in progress. |
++---+-------------------------------------------------+----------+------------------------------------------------------+
